/**********************************************************************

    Am9513A/Am9513 System Timing Controller (STC)

    The Am9513 is a five-channel counter/timer circuit introduced by
    AMD around 1980. (It was also sold as the AmZ8073, apparently due
    to a licensing deal with Zilog to develop Z8000 peripherals. No
    company is known to have second-sourced the device, however.)
    Clock source, edge selection, gating and retriggering are
    programmable for each channel. There is also a frequency divider
    which can take any of the 15 normal counter inputs and divide it
    by any number between 1 and 16.

    All internal counters are 16 bits wide (except the internal 4-bit
    counter for the FOUT divider, which is not externally accessible).
    The device defaults to an 8-bit external interface after being
    powered on or a programmed master reset, but can be configured to
    work more efficiently with an 16-bit data bus.

    There is no reset line, though the device does reset itself when
    it powers on, and there is a "master reset" software command.

    For a full description of each counter mode, see the datasheet.

**********************************************************************/
